Eugene is the son of Leonard Carl and Hannah Jane (Pratt) Wilsey. He was 79 yrs 8 mos 13 days when he died of a stroke. He married Melinda Bell at Wautoma in 1885.

Obituary:
E. P. Wilsey Died Suddenly Sat Oct 12, 1935
Eugene Pratt Wilsey, 79 for many years a resident of Pittsville, Wisconsin, passed away on Saturday, Oct 12 at 3:20 o'clock in the morning, at the home of his granddaugter, Mrs. Harry Stark, at Wisconsin Rapids. Death was caused by a stroke.
Funeral services were held at the Congregational Church, with the Rev. R. B. O'Neill officiating on Monday Morning at 2:o'clock and interment was made in Mound Cemetery, Pittsville, Mr. Wilsey was born at Madison on January 29, 1856 and spent his early life there. Later he moved to Menomonie, and came to the Pittsville district from that city in the year 1880. For 12 years he was employed in a stove mill in this city, later laking up the painter trade. He also operated the Standard Oil Co., bulk plant in this city for nine years.
He was united in Marriage to Melinda Bell, at Wautoma in the year 1885,
He is survived by his widow, one daughter, Mrs. Ernest Brown, of Superior, three grandchildren, Mrs. Harry Stark and Mrs. Merle Bender of Wisconsin Rapids and Dorine Brown of Superior. One brother George of Menomonie and one sister Mrs. Clara Douglas of Maidstone, Canada also survive.
